APPLICATION LAYER -...

16
KEMAL ADE SEKARWATI APPLICATION LAYER

Transcript of APPLICATION LAYER -...

Page 1: APPLICATION LAYER - ade.staff.gunadarma.ac.idade.staff.gunadarma.ac.id/Downloads/files/60743/07+Applicationt+Layer.pdf · TCP/IP & OSI •Dalam terminologi model referensi OSI, TCP/IP

KEMAL ADE SEKARWATI

APPLICATION LAYER

Page 2: APPLICATION LAYER - ade.staff.gunadarma.ac.idade.staff.gunadarma.ac.id/Downloads/files/60743/07+Applicationt+Layer.pdf · TCP/IP & OSI •Dalam terminologi model referensi OSI, TCP/IP

Physical

Application

Presentation

Session

Transport

Network

Data Link

1

2

7

6

5

4

3

• Upper layers application issues pada umumnya diimplementasikan secara software • Application oriented

• Lower layers data transport issues Layer 1 & 2 :h/w & s/w implemented Layer 3 dan 4 : s/w implemented • Network oriented

Page 3: APPLICATION LAYER - ade.staff.gunadarma.ac.idade.staff.gunadarma.ac.id/Downloads/files/60743/07+Applicationt+Layer.pdf · TCP/IP & OSI •Dalam terminologi model referensi OSI, TCP/IP

TCP/IP & OSI

• Dalam terminologi model referensi OSI, TCP/IP protocol suite meliputi network dan transport layers

• TCP/IP dapat diterapkan pada bermacam data-link layers (mampu mendukung bermacam implementasi hardware jaringan)

Physical

Application

Presentation

Session

Transport

Network

Data Link

1

2

7

6

5

4

3

Network inteface

Application

Transport

IP

1

3

4

2

OSI TCP/IP

Page 4: APPLICATION LAYER - ade.staff.gunadarma.ac.idade.staff.gunadarma.ac.id/Downloads/files/60743/07+Applicationt+Layer.pdf · TCP/IP & OSI •Dalam terminologi model referensi OSI, TCP/IP

Network inteface

Application

Transport

IP

TCP/IP

Software outside the operating system

Software inside the operating system

Only IP addresses used

Physical addresses used

Page 5: APPLICATION LAYER - ade.staff.gunadarma.ac.idade.staff.gunadarma.ac.id/Downloads/files/60743/07+Applicationt+Layer.pdf · TCP/IP & OSI •Dalam terminologi model referensi OSI, TCP/IP

Application Layer

• Layer OSI yang paling dekat dengan end user

• Berinteraksi dengan aplikasi perangkat lunak yang menerapkan suatu komponen untuk berkomunikasi

• Fungsi :

– Menentukan partner komunikasi

– Menentukan ketersediaan resource

– Sinkronisasi komunikasi

Page 6: APPLICATION LAYER - ade.staff.gunadarma.ac.idade.staff.gunadarma.ac.id/Downloads/files/60743/07+Applicationt+Layer.pdf · TCP/IP & OSI •Dalam terminologi model referensi OSI, TCP/IP

• Contoh :

– Telnet, FTP, SMTP (TCP/IP suit)

– OSI Common Management Information Protocol (CMIP)

Page 7: APPLICATION LAYER - ade.staff.gunadarma.ac.idade.staff.gunadarma.ac.id/Downloads/files/60743/07+Applicationt+Layer.pdf · TCP/IP & OSI •Dalam terminologi model referensi OSI, TCP/IP

Internet (TCP/IP) protocol stack

• application : mendukung aplikasi jaringan

– ftp, smtp, http application

transport

network

link

physical

Page 8: APPLICATION LAYER - ade.staff.gunadarma.ac.idade.staff.gunadarma.ac.id/Downloads/files/60743/07+Applicationt+Layer.pdf · TCP/IP & OSI •Dalam terminologi model referensi OSI, TCP/IP

DNS = Domain Name System (Service) protocol

Merupakan distributed Internet directory service.

DNS banyak digunakan untuk mentranslasikan antara domain name dengan IP address dan digunakan untuk mengendalikan pengiriman Internet email.

Domain Name System (DNS)

Page 9: APPLICATION LAYER - ade.staff.gunadarma.ac.idade.staff.gunadarma.ac.id/Downloads/files/60743/07+Applicationt+Layer.pdf · TCP/IP & OSI •Dalam terminologi model referensi OSI, TCP/IP

DNS memiliki dua aspek independent :

• Menspesifikasi sintaks nama dan aturan untuk pendelegasian authority melalui nama.

Sintaksnya adalah : local.group.site

• Menspesifikasikan implementasi dari distributed computing system yang mengefisiensikan pemetaan antara nama dan alamat.

Page 10: APPLICATION LAYER - ade.staff.gunadarma.ac.idade.staff.gunadarma.ac.id/Downloads/files/60743/07+Applicationt+Layer.pdf · TCP/IP & OSI •Dalam terminologi model referensi OSI, TCP/IP

File Transfer Protocol (FTP) memungkinkan sharing file antar host.

FTP menggunakan TCP untuk membuat koneksi virtual untuk kontrol informasi dan kemudian membuat koneksi TCP yang terpisah untuk transfer data.

File Transfer Protocol (FTP)

Page 11: APPLICATION LAYER - ade.staff.gunadarma.ac.idade.staff.gunadarma.ac.id/Downloads/files/60743/07+Applicationt+Layer.pdf · TCP/IP & OSI •Dalam terminologi model referensi OSI, TCP/IP

Fungsi penting dari FTP adalah :

1. untuk mendukung sharing dari file (program komputer dan atau data);

2. untuk mendorong secara tidak langsung atau secara lengkap (melalui program) penggunaan computer remote;

3. untuk melindungi pengguna dari variasi dalam file storage systems diantara hosts;

4. untuk mentransfer data secara reliable dan efisien.

Page 12: APPLICATION LAYER - ade.staff.gunadarma.ac.idade.staff.gunadarma.ac.id/Downloads/files/60743/07+Applicationt+Layer.pdf · TCP/IP & OSI •Dalam terminologi model referensi OSI, TCP/IP

HTTP : Hypertext Transfer Protocol

HTTP :

protokol pada level aplikasi dengan keringanan dan kecepatan yang diperlukan untuk distribusi, kolaborasi, sistem informasi hipermedia.

HTTP banyak digunakan oleh World-Wide Web global information sejak 1990.

Page 13: APPLICATION LAYER - ade.staff.gunadarma.ac.idade.staff.gunadarma.ac.id/Downloads/files/60743/07+Applicationt+Layer.pdf · TCP/IP & OSI •Dalam terminologi model referensi OSI, TCP/IP

IMAP & IMAP4 : Internet Message Access Protocol (version 4)

• IMAP : suatu metode untuk mengakses email yang tersimpan pada server email.

• IMAP mengijinkan program email klien untuk mengakses pesan yang tersimpan secara remote seperti tersimpan di lokal.

• Email yang tersimpan pada server IMAP dapat dimanipulasi dari komputer desktop secara remote, tanpa perlu mentransfer pesan atau files bolak-balik antara komputer.

Page 14: APPLICATION LAYER - ade.staff.gunadarma.ac.idade.staff.gunadarma.ac.id/Downloads/files/60743/07+Applicationt+Layer.pdf · TCP/IP & OSI •Dalam terminologi model referensi OSI, TCP/IP

POP and POP3 : Post Office Protocol (version 3)

• Post Office Protocol didesain untuk mengijinkan komputer workstation untuk secara dinamik mengakses email yang terdapat pada server host.

• POP3 adalah versi terakhir saat ini.

• Transmisi POP3 terlihat seperti pesan data antar host. Pesan berupa perintah atau pesan balasan.

Page 15: APPLICATION LAYER - ade.staff.gunadarma.ac.idade.staff.gunadarma.ac.id/Downloads/files/60743/07+Applicationt+Layer.pdf · TCP/IP & OSI •Dalam terminologi model referensi OSI, TCP/IP

SMTP : Simple Mail Transfer Protocol

• SMTP adalah sebuah protokol yang didesain untuk transfer email secara reliable dan efisien.

• SMTP adalah layanan surat yang dimodelkan pada layanan transfer file FTP.

• SMTP mentransfer pesan email antara sistem dan menyediakan peringatan berkaitan dengan email yang masuk.

Page 16: APPLICATION LAYER - ade.staff.gunadarma.ac.idade.staff.gunadarma.ac.id/Downloads/files/60743/07+Applicationt+Layer.pdf · TCP/IP & OSI •Dalam terminologi model referensi OSI, TCP/IP

Terima kasih